Security Forces Foil Twin Bandit Attacks in Sokoto, Recover Rustled Livestock

In a renewed wave of violence, suspected Lakurawa bandits launched coordinated attacks on two communities in Tangaza Local Government Area of Sokoto State on April 7, 2025, PRNigeria reports.

However, swift responses by security forces helped to repel the assailants and recover some stolen livestock.

The first incident occurred at about 11:30 a.m. in Takkau Village, Gongono District, where approximately thirty armed bandits stormed the area on motorcycles, firing sporadically into the air to instill panic.

According to Zagazola, villagers fled their homes, leaving behind properties and domestic animals. The hoodlums capitalized on the chaos to rustle an unspecified number of livestock before fleeing.

In response to a distress call, a joint team of security forces conducted a search-and-rescue operation. While some of the stolen animals were successfully recovered, efforts are still ongoing to apprehend the fleeing criminals.

Meanwhile, later the same day—around 11:30 p.m. another group of suspected Lakurawa bandits attacked Sutti Village and Sutti Kwarakka Ward, also in Tangaza LGA. This time, about 40 gunmen on motorcycles invaded the communities under the cover of night, firing indiscriminately.

However, in a prompt counterattack, troops of Operation FANSAN YANMA engaged the assailants in a fierce gun battle, forcing them to retreat into the nearby bushes.

Two villagers sustained gunshot wounds during the exchange—one in the right hand and the other in the left leg. They were quickly evacuated to the General Hospital for treatment and are currently responding well.
